Tae Young Yune is a scholar working on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Neurology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Tae Young Yune has authored 67 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ine, 21 papers in Neurology and 18 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Tae Young Yune’s work include Spinal Cord Injury Research (30 papers), Neuroinflammation and Neurodegeneration Mechanisms (18 papers) and Nerve injury and regeneration (13 papers). Tae Young Yune is often cited by papers focused on Spinal Cord Injury Research (30 papers), Neuroinflammation and Neurodegeneration Mechanisms (18 papers) and Nerve injury and regeneration (13 papers). Tae Young Yune coll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Hong Kong. Tae Young Yune's co-authors include Tae Hwan Oh, Jee Y. Lee, Jee Youn Lee, Young C. Kim, George J. Markelonis, Hae Young Choi, Sun Jung Kim, Young Jun Oh, Bong Gun Ju and Hye Young Choi and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Neuroscience, PLoS ONE and Brain.
